"Khawaja Farm House" is located in Dera Ghazi Khan, Pakistan on MJPW8FM, Khawaja Farm House, near CM Punjab House, Taunsa. "Khawaja Farm House" is rated 4.6 out of 5 in the category orchid farm in Pakistan.
Address
MJPW8FM, Khawaja Farm House, near CM Punjab House, Taunsa